Los Fresnitos
Los Fresnitos is an intermittent stream in Sonora, Northern Mexico and has an elevation of 1,332 metres. Los Fresnitos is situated nearby to the locality Corral de Enmedio, as well as near the abandoned locality Las Pompilas.- Type: Intermittent stream
